Salt Weather in August
August in Salt brings high temperatures, with highs of 30°C (86°F) and nights dropping to 19°C (66°F). Rainfall is on the higher side this month, averaging around 64 mm (2.5 in), so keep a rain jacket handy.
Rainfall in Salt in August
Past climate data indicates that roughly 9 days will see rain, totalling around 64 mm (2.5 in) for the month. Individual showers can be quite heavy this month. A proper umbrella or rain jacket is worth having.
Temperature in Salt in August
If you're visiting Salt in August, expect highs of 30°C (86°F) and overnight lows around 19°C (66°F). Conditions stay fairly consistent through the month, making it easier to plan what to wear. With lows of 19°C (66°F), nights are cool. If you're out after dark, an extra layer will keep you comfortable. The cooler air at night is also great for getting a good rest. This is typically the warmest month of the year, so light summer clothing is a good idea.
Sunshine in Salt in August
With approximately 262 hours of sunshine, the days are filled with clear skies. What to Wear in Salt in August
Warm weather calls for comfortable, breathable clothing in August. Cotton t-shirts, shorts, light dresses, and sandals are perfect. You might still want a light layer for evenings or air-conditioned places (for example buses). Rain is likely on several days, so bring a good rain jacket.
